Charlize regrets lack of preparation
Charlize Theron regrets not training harder for Prometheus. The 36-year-old actress, who plays corporate figurehead Meredith Vickers in the Ridley Scott-directed sci-fi movie, felt out of shape while filming “sexy” running scenes because and thinks they turned out looking more “ugly” than attractive due to her lack of preparation for the role.
She said, “I probably should have trained a little bit because I found myself in the middle of Iceland having to run with all this heavy gear on my back. It was one take of sexy running and then I was all ugly running. Ridley going, ‘Run. Run!’ was pretty much the ugly running.”
Charlize found her transformation into a hard-nosed businesswoman in the motion picture, which follows the crew of the Prometheus space ship in 2085 as they go in search of aliens, came to her naturally as soon as she donned a suit.
She added to Hello! magazine, “I don’t ever set out to play a character with strength. I try to kind of find the circumstance and try to be as honest as I can.”
